Steve is right!  If you are a tinkerer, you can make your own smoker.  Lots on the market, but others on SMF have built their own with great results.

Another good investment is a good thermometer that can monitor both the smoker temp and the interior temp on the meat.  Make sure you calibrate the thermo to assure you are getting a correct temp reading. 

A lot of the people here (myself included) have experienced the same problems and eaten their mistakes to get through it.  Practice, practice, practice, and don't get discouraged.
